In April 1998, WWE came to the WWS (then the WWA) looking for a place where the next generation of WWE stars could compete, and the WWS began serving as WWF's official developmental territory.

Damien Sandow, Kenny Dykstra, John Quinlan, and R. J. Brewer.[2] Quinlan actually had his debut match in the WWA facing Brewer on November 26, 1999.[3][4]
The promotion's last show was held on November 13, 2010, following the death of longtime commissioner Bob Ambrose.
